Acai Bubbles
1 oz Van Gogh Acai-Blueberry Vodka, 1/2 oz blueberry schnapps, 1/4 oz blueberry juice, 3 oz chilled champagne
Pour vodka, schnapps, and juice into champagne flute. Top with champagne and enjoy! Garnish with a blueberry in the bottom of the fluted glass.
